Method performance parameters for soil analysis.

Antibiotics %Recovery (%RSD), n = 3
%ME Linearity (r2) MDLs (ng·g−1) MQLs (ng·g−1)
10.0 ng·g−1 30.0 ng·g−1 50.0 ng·g−1
Ceftiofur 42.9 (2.8) 48.2 (3.8) 30.5 (9.2) 96.3 0.9993 0.2 0.8
Trimethoprim 128.7 (7.2) 151.1 (3.1) 138.9 (8.8) 59.4 0.9987 0.1 0.4
Enrofloxacin 35.5 (14.0) 32.9 (18.1) 26.7 (15.7) 281.2 0.9925 0.5 1.7
Marbofloxacin 34.7 (4.4) 39.2 (15.1) 38.6 (15.6) 123.7 0.9964 0.3 0.9
Monensin 22.5 (15.9) 23.2 (8.0) 21.2 (3.0) 29.1 0.9991 0.06 0.2
Salinomycin 31.4 (27.9) 55.8 (5.0) 55.1 (3.4) 82.5 0.9988 0.3 0.9
Clindamycin 127.7 (4.7) 154.4 (2.6) 152.4 (4.5) 96.8 0.9983 0.1 0.3
Lincomycin 109.0 (2.8) 120.3 (7.1) 115.5 (1.5) 74.8 0.9986 0.5 1.7
Clarithromycin 116.3 (11.7) 157.1 (4.1) 151.3 (6.9) 56.9 0.9958 0.2 0.8
Metronidazole 25.9 (16.7) 27.8 (3.6) 27.3 (9.5) 76.5 0.9976 0.2 0.8
Florfenicol 50.8 (6.1) 61.8 (10.3) 66.9 (6.8) 70.3 0.9978 0.4 1.2
Tiamulin 99.3 (9.1) 129.3 (4.0) 131.7 (9.1) 63.8 0.9982 0.06 0.2
Pipemidic acid 10.0 (0.6) 10.3 (3.5) 11.3 (3.9) 168.2 0.9868 0.7 2.4
Virginiamycin M 66.2 (2.3) 63.1 (7.2) 72.5 (2.1) 120.0 0.9970 0.03 0.1
Virginiamycin S 72.7 (3.6) 82.4 (0.6) 87.9 (0) 96.5 0.9989 0.4 1.2
Sulfadiazine 114.7 (4.8) 127.7 (14.2) 121.4 (2.9) 61.0 0.9969 0.09 0.3
Sulfamethazine 106.2 (1.8) 111.7 (1.3) 112.4 (5.4) 72.4 0.9987 0.06 0.2
Sulfamethoxazole 119.7 (2.9) 139.3 (2.1) 142.8 (4.1) 79.5 0.9976 0.06 0.2
Sulfapyridine 122.3 (19.6) 140.0 (11.5) 117.3 (8.7) 60.8 0.9957 0.1 0.5
Chlortetracycline 18.4 (6.5) 24.3 (3.6) 29.3 (26.0) 22.1 0.9983 0.7 2.5
Doxytetracycline 73.4 (4.4) 64.0 (13.1) 66.3 (19.7) 180.3 0.9962 1.4 4.8
Oxytetracycline 18.8 (10.0) 14.8 (11.3) 21.9 (38.9) 117.5 0.9935 3.1 10.2
Tetracycline 42.7 (12.3) 53.8 (8.7) 52.9 (21.8) 137.0 0.9983 2.1 7.0
